Student Population
Gods Bible School and College educates a diverse community of 533 students, with 498 pursuing undergraduate degrees and 35 engaged in advanced graduate studies.
Total Enrollment
533
Total Undergraduates
498
Total Graduates
35
42% Full-Time
58% Part-Time

Admissions
The admission process at Gods Bible School and College has a 64% acceptance rate. Gods Bible School and College has test required that focus on each student's unique potential.
Acceptance Rate
64%
Application Fee
$0
SAT
Students submitting SAT
2%
ACT
Students submitting ACT
0%

Cost
Gods Bible School and College makes education accessible, offering an average net price of $9,478 with 100% of students receiving financial assistance including 23% benefiting from Pell Grants.
Average Net Price
$9,478
Received Aid
100%
Pell Recipients
23%
$3,300 In-State
$3,300 Out-of-State
